Koreansunflower has nice learner’s podcasts on her channel. There’s also Storytime in korean, no recent videos there but the ones that have been posted are pretty nice. 속닥복닥 Korean podcast also seems quite nice, but I’m not super familiar with the channel so you can just check it out and see if you like it.

In addition, 몰입한국어 is a great resource, although it’s not exactly a podcast but rather small stories. Similarly, for more listening practice, you can check out 태웅쌤’s channel where he plays games, not a podcast but great nonetheless.

And once you start getting closer to intermediate, you can listen to podcasts like Didi’s Korean culture podcast and 태웅쌤’s All things korean podcast.

한국어 한 조각 has a podcast (and some other video resources) for beginners on both YT and spotify (and maybe Apple?). They have free PDFs for the intermediate podcast so you might want to check if they’re offered for the beginner level as well!
